My work ranges from full dinnerware sets to one of a kind art pieces. A
huge part of me goes into every pot I make. It begins with a lump of
white stoneware clay, which I value for its excellent thermal properties
for use in cookware. I use a wheel to throw parts, as well as an extruder
and slab roller. After the parts are made and trimmed, the assembly
creation begins, a time consuming affair that I enjoy the most.
